American Aires Inc
American Aires Inc., a nanotechnology company, engages in the production, sales, and distribution of electromagnetic protection devices in Canada and internationally. American Aires Inc (AAIRF) - Total Liabilities
Latest total liabilities as of September 2025: $8.87 Million USD
Based on the latest financial reports, American Aires Inc (AAIRF) has total liabilities worth $8.87 Million USD as of September 2025.
Total liabilities represent everything the company owes to external parties, combining both current liabilities—like accounts payable, short-term debt, and accrued expenses—and non-current liabilities such as long-term debt, pension obligations, lease liabilities, and deferred tax liabilities.

Liquidity & Leverage Metrics
Key Metrics Explained
| Metric | Value | Description |
|---|---|---|
| Current Ratio | 0.37 | Measures ability to pay short-term obligations (Current Assets ÷ Current Liabilities) |
| Quick Ratio | N/A | More stringent measure of short-term liquidity ((Current Assets - Inventory) ÷ Current Liabilities) |
| Cash Ratio | N/A | Most conservative liquidity measure (Cash & Equivalents ÷ Current Liabilities) |
| Debt to Equity | -1.59 | Measures financial leverage (Total Liabilities ÷ Shareholder Equity) |
| Debt to Assets | 2.68 | Portion of assets financed with debt (Total Liabilities ÷ Total Assets) |

Annual Total Liabilities for American Aires Inc (2016–2024)
The table below shows the annual total liabilities of American Aires Inc from 2016 to 2024.
| Year | Total Liabilities |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 2024-12-31 | $5.90 Million | +141.28% |
| 2023-12-31 | $2.44 Million | -37.62% |
| 2022-12-31 | $3.92 Million | +176.21% |
| 2021-12-31 | $1.42 Million | +92.82% |
| 2020-12-31 | $735.87K | +51.86% |
| 2019-12-31 | $484.56K | -35.15% |
| 2018-12-31 | $747.23K | +25.15% |
| 2017-12-31 | $597.05K | -32.91% |
| 2016-12-31 | $889.98K | -- |
